Thank you for your quick response.

What happened is as follows:

I installed an update this morning to Topaz SharpenAI which included a plugin for PS.

Something happened after that where PSCC would not open. I got a popup message that Creative Cloud was damaged and would I like to fix it?  I click on yes and that's when things got messy.

PS refused to open-and  I then noticed that the creative cloud app was missing

I then wrote the above  request  which you replied to.

But right after I wrote my question above, I decided to reboot and see if that helped

It did.  PSCC and Bridge now open and the latest Topaz plug-in is working  from the filter drop-down.

Now I'm thinking that the CC app itself was damaged earlier and I didn't realize it.

Rebooting brought back PS but not the CC app.

 

Since I pretty much only use PS and sometimes Bridge, I'm wondering if there is any advantage for me to reinstall the full Creative Cloud suite at this time.  I'm assuming that if I want to use one of the other programs on CC that are covered by my subscription, I can just download it and use it as a stand-alone without the Creative Cloud app, when needed    Am I correct?
